Output ee8f6431b6d26f26a146a8d2ffddb7fa5305bd8eb1032e4e2e19e8cee5d8ecae:0

value
831364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ddc5ae8da791675dbbf6b2044a1c6c9116ec63f5 OP_EQUAL
address
3Mue57ZYBt8T7nnCEFABb1gnvxfQq78wp5
transaction
ee8f6431b6d26f26a146a8d2ffddb7fa5305bd8eb1032e4e2e19e8cee5d8ecae
confirmations
276373
spent
true